In this experiment, masses measured in grams (g) are used to calculate resistances and efforts. using. newton’s second law, 𝐹 = 𝑚𝑎, the net force would equal the product of the masses times gravity ( 𝑔). Explore six simple machines including levers, inclined planes, pulleys, wedges, screws, and wheel and axle systems. compute mechanical advantage, efficiency with friction, and force distance trade offs. Simple machines are devices that can be used to multiply or augment a force that we apply, often at the expense of a distance through which we apply the force. the word for “machine” comes from the greek word meaning “to help make things easier.”.
